Best for earning high APY: UFB Preferred Savings (previously known as UFB Best Savings) Best for no fees: Marcus by ... how to study for longer hoursWebApr 13, 2024 · What is the Savings Deposit Program? The DOD Savings Deposit Program is a service that provides members of the uniformed services actively serving in designated combat zones the opportunity to build their savings. Qualified members will earn 10% interest annually on a maximum of $10,000. reading ekg rhythm stripsWebApr 5, 2024 · As with the Chase savings account interest rates, you could easily find higher CD rates at an online bank.
